Inzombiac posted:

Oh man, that's a good idea, if not extremely nerdy. I've been eyeballing a Surface 3 for drawing on the train and slow times at work. Is it really nice or just an adequate substitute?

I own a Cintiq 21X also, so I can say that it is actually very nice. It doesn't have over 2000 levels of pressure like the Cintiq, but it is not as huge of a difference as you'd think. I use Photoshop, mainly, for drawing and I had to tweak that a little bit to get it to play nice. By default it's zoomed out so much because of the screen resolution that it's impossible to hit any of the little icons, but turning on 200% zoom mode in the experimental settings fixed that just fine. You can download an app from the Windows Store (simply called 'Surface') to tweak the pressure settings more to your liking since the defaults aren't great. But once you get things how you like them, it's honestly very pleasing to use for art.

The thing I'd very highly recommend is also getting a screen protector for it, not because the screen is fragile, but because it's made of glass and is very slippery to draw on. When I first got the Surface I thought this was going to be a deal breaker, it felt so wrong to draw on and it was so slick and shiny and ughhh, but I got this matte screen protector and that fixed all of my issues. It makes the screen a little more grippy like what you'd feel on a Cintiq and it eliminates glare so you can actually see what you're doing. I don't know how anyone goes on using their Surface day to day without one of these.

At the end of the day I'm very happy with it and I paid less than half of what a Cintiq Companion with comparable specs costs. This website is a good resource if you want to read more about it.

Opioid posted:

I've got a paperwhite as well. What do you like about the voyage over paperwhite?

Honestly my original reason for wanting to switch is pretty stupid - I liked the fact that the Voyage's screen is flush with the bezel. I always had issues keeping the space where the screen meets the bezel on the Paperwhite free of dust and fuzzes even though it has always been kept in a case and it bugged me. Definitely satisfied as far as that goes. I've been using it for a few days and while I didn't think I'd care about it when I was still considering the purchase, I've come to really love the PagePress buttons on the sides of the screen. You just kinda squeeze the edge and the page turns, giving a tiny bit of haptic feedback to let you know you've squeezed hard enough. I like using that way more than swiping the screen.

Seems more responsive and feels a lot nicer in hand since it's not made of plastic (this is magnesium and a non-glare glass). The text also seems crisper on the Voyage than on the Paperwhite.

I didn't need to upgrade, but I'm very pleased that I did.

Josh Lyman posted:

I might be interested in the paper white if you can convince me I'd use it. I don't have an e-reader and just read the forums in bed on my iPhone.

I guess it's just a matter of how much you read whether it'd be useful to you or not. I definitely notice that I don't get the eye strain using it that I do reading things on a computer or tablet, so if you read a lot this is a bonus for sure. You can carry tons of books around, check out books from your local library with it (disclaimer: this does require a computer, you can't do it directly from the device), and even send articles to it for reading later with a service like Readability or Pocket. The battery lasts forever too, like a month, so you don't really have to worry about your battery level like you would on a phone or tablet.

It's just personal taste, I guess. My boyfriend reads way more than I do and I can't sell him on it even though I absolutely love mine.
